International Women's Day: And yet we still need to celebrate it

International Women's Day: And yet we still need to celebrate it photo
International Women's Day is celebrated every year on March 8, as a reminder of the achievements of women around the world. It began as a street protest in New York in 1908 by women demanding the right to vote, shorter working hours and better wages. Since then, the celebration has changed many forms and is an international event supported by many countries, governments and organizations.

Why should there be an international women's day?

In this day and age, it may seem like women have equal opportunities with men. There are women in many important positions, managers and prime ministers. However, statistics show that there is still a long way for women to achieve full equality with men. According to his research with the BBC a few years ago, in England women occupied only 30,9% of the majority of senior jobs in areas such as politics, business and policing. 

So while progress has certainly been made since 1908, there is still a long way to go before we see equal numbers of men and women in important jobs, and equal pay.
